She’s back. Tori was the original one to have this sound. Then along came a heap of artists who copied that sound but nobody quite got it right. It is like there are a million Elvis impersonators out there but there is only one Elvis.

Tori tried to reinvent herself for a while, and while imitation is supposed to be the highest form of flattery, I suspect that was part of the reason why she attempted the change up.

Thankfully, and by no means any disrespect to her other ventures and styles, we have the only person who can truly be Tori Forsyth back. And boy, is she back.

This is stunning. She re-entered the limelight of country music with Shane Nicholson very quietly with Golden Guitar nominated song, Sometimes. So quietly that I didn’t know that it existed until it was nominated. I am usually like a seagull with a breadcrumb when I hear about a song from either artist.

It hinted that there would be more and indeed, here it is. I went to an early gig of Tori’s at the Django Bar, and she blew me away. She obviously draws from folks like Emmylou Harris and Melanie (who recently passed away) but she’s not a copycat.

While she says that she never really left country because she is a country girl, essentially, this album is more country than she has recorded in a while. Yes, there are twists and several shades of country music, but it is country.

Tori likes to mix things up, but that voice is the centre of every song. She can sing upbeat, slow it down, go middle ground and she can still carry that load.

While Shane sings Sometimes with her, the album is produced by Scott Horscroft. It essentially has all of the same feels of her previous country work, so he doesn’t change that up too much.

He lets Tori be Tori. Like Shane did.

Alchemist has such a cool groove, it is a serious subject which almost sounds fun because of the melody.

Good Enough with Kasey Chambers is magical. I love All we are and Didn’t Mean A Thing. Every track is a winner and it is hard to pick favourites. You can’t get much more country than You made your bed. I keep thinking, (by the tune) that the bad guys are about to ride into town. Past and Present is classic Tori.

Dawn of the Dark is one of my favourite Aussie Country music albums of all time. This one will be good company for that one.

Welcome back.
